Pistol_Pete posted:Barrow already looks pretty hosed: if the nuclear submarines go, they're completely hosed and they know it: They're a poor community at the end of an isolated peninsula and no other employment in the town. I understand a bit better why they're so stubborn about clinging on to their machinery of death now. Barrow also builds the non Trident attack submarines (which no party has suggested scrapping, though they have been cut from 12 to 7 in recent years primarily due to defence cuts rather than strategic decisions). Regardless of Trident, it should be possible to guarantee continued work for Barrow.
